Anatomical Terms- Directional Terms
Superior (cranial)-Toward the head end or upper part of a structure or the body; above
Inferior (caudal)- Away from the head end or toward the lower part of a structure or the body; below
Anterior (ventral)- Toward or at the front of the body; in the front
Posterior (dorsal)- Toward or at the back of the body; behind
Medial- Toward or at the midline of the body; on the inner side
Lateral- Away from the midline of the body; on the outer side of
Intermediate- Between a more medial and a more laterals structure
Proximal- Closer to the origin of the body part or the point of attachment of a limb to the body trunk
Distal- Farther from the origin of a body part or the point of attachment of a limb to the body trunk
Superficial (external)- Toward or at the body surface
Deep (internal)- Away from the body surface; more internal
